Finance Review Summary — Hiring Freeze, Calderon Division

Following the mid-year review, all open requisitions in the Calderon division are frozen effective immediately, pending a full cost-base assessment. Backfills require CFO approval; contractor extensions capped at 90 days. Branch managers should update staffing plans accordingly and route exceptions through regional finance. Other divisions are unaffected at this time. The confidential note below explains the plan driving this measure.

board note of tawig-bajof: The renewal with Ralixix Holdings closes at $10 million a year, 20 percent above the last contract. Project Druix slips by two quarters because of the tooling delay.

Ticket: Config drift detected on LedgerLens audit-log viewer

Priority: Medium. The nightly drift check flagged LedgerLens in the prod-east cluster: three settings diverge from what's committed in the config repo. Someone appears to have hand-edited retention and page-size values during last week's incident and never backported the change. No user-facing impact yet, but search pagination behaves differently across replicas. Please reconcile before the next deploy. For reference, the expected committed values are listed below.

settings of fafog-haduf:
ZORIX_PIN=4648
ZORIX_METRICS_HOST=metrics.zorix.paliqsys.corp
ZORIX_LOG_LEVEL=info
ZORIX_TENANT=druix

Handing off the Quillbus broker upgrade (4.x to 5.1) to Dario. Cluster is half-migrated; mixed-version mode is supported but TLS cert rotation must finish before cutover. No auth model changes, though the admin API gained two new endpoints worth reviewing. Open questions and the migration checklist are tracked on the internal page below.

dashboard of taduf-bawef = https://jira.lumicsys.internal/projects/display/browse/b1cbf89d

## Further reading

The `keyshuffle` utility handles scheduled rotation of service secrets across all Brindlewood environments. Before proposing changes at the eng sync, please review how rotation windows interact with the credential cache: rotating outside an approved window can strand long-lived workers on stale secrets, which is the failure mode behind most past incidents. Design rationale, rotation window definitions, and the emergency rotation procedure are all documented on the internal page below.

runbook for tagef-tagef: https://confluence.qorvelcorp.internal/display/browse/view/67670d0e2976